Mustang is a great car to work on. Upgrading performance is easy and very inexpensive. Eibach 2" lowering springs made it able to handle any turn at 60 miles per hour, for only $375 installed. The sound on these mustangs are unmistakeable, with a cheap 2 chamber flow master exhaust. Free up the ponies and let them ride. Its a sin to have a stock Mustang GT. Better all around compared to my 2002 Mercedes c230 kompressor. Wish I still had the Mustang.

I absolutely LOVE my red '97 mustang! Its more reliable than any car i've had and it gets me everywhere. Im the second owner and had very MINIMAL problems, the biggest thing ive had to get done was the clutch. Ive gotten a new oil pan and fixed a water leak, but after 14 years can you believe thats the only work? I kept up this car from the minute i bought it. I was devastated when i got in an accident in december and totaled the car, but the safety was great and me and my little brother are alive. 210,000 miles the car still ran like a champ, wish i still had it. This car has been my nice weather car since I bought it back in 97. The performance is what you'd expect from a Mustang and fuel economy was actually good. I put a cold air intake, cat-back exhaust and Hypertech power programmer on the car and is much faster than stock. The reliability has been good except for some minor brake and radiator problems. Probably spent around $600 in repairs since owning it. I really like the styling on the interior and the front seats are pretty comfortable. the manual trans has been good and no problems, just replaced clutch once. Overall very satisfied with my purchase and hope the 06 Mustang I'm buying this spring will be just as good a car as this one.
